Roof repair services involve identifying and fixing issues that compromise the integrity and functionality of a roof. These services typically include patching leaks, replacing damaged shingles or tiles, sealing cracks, and addressing structural problems that may lead to further damage. Proper roof repairs help prevent water intrusion, reduce the risk of mold growth, and extend the lifespan of the roof. Property owners who notice signs of damage, such as missing shingles, water stains on ceilings, or visible cracks, can benefit from professional repair work to maintain the safety and durability of their roofs.
Many common problems can be addressed through roof repair services. These include leaks caused by damaged or missing roofing materials, storm or wind damage, and wear from aging. Additionally, issues such as sagging sections, loose flashing, or cracked seals can lead to more serious problems if left unattended. Repairing these issues promptly can prevent more costly repairs or the need for complete roof replacement in the future. The overview below groups typical Roof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- typical costs range from $250-$600 for many routine fixes like replacing shingles or sealing leaks. Most small projects fall within this range, but prices can vary based on roof size and material. Larger or more complex repairs may cost more.
Moderate Repairs - projects such as extensive patching or fixing multiple leaks usually cost between $600-$2,000. Many of these jobs land in the middle of this range, with fewer reaching the higher end depending on roof condition and access.
Major Overhauls - significant repairs involving structural issues or extensive damage typically range from $2,000-$5,000. These are less common but necessary for roofs with widespread problems or older systems requiring extensive work.
Full Roof Replacement - replacing an entire roof generally costs between $7,000-$20,000+, depending on the size, material, and complexity of the project. Most replacements fall within the lower to middle part of this range, with larger or high-end materials pushing costs higher.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
